Output 3ca03da75c94ddd0d80eb3ba0b718517d7ad0540aed47d53573aa48d03a5d564:5

value
39850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cb701a9a0698eac4c0041899ebf0053655af7e3 OP_EQUAL
address
35mStVs3VPaiZS5PGeDauLe8TZcTYZ8jxF
transaction
3ca03da75c94ddd0d80eb3ba0b718517d7ad0540aed47d53573aa48d03a5d564
spent
true